What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device (computer, mobile phone, tablet, or other devices) when you visit a website. They contain data that help us recognize you during your visits or record your preferences to improve your user experience. Cookies can store information for a single session ("session cookies") or for multiple sessions ("persistent cookies").
The information collected can include your preferences in website navigation, language settings, and other technical data that enhance the functionality and performance of our site. The use of cookies is a common industry practice employed to ensure that our online services function seamlessly and securely.

Data Retention Periods
The retention period for data collected via cookies depends on the type of cookie being used:
- Session Cookies: These cookies are automatically deleted from your device once you close your browser, ensuring that session-specific information does not persist beyond your visit.
- Persistent Cookies: These cookies remain on your device for a designated period, which may range from a few days to several months or more. The exact duration is dependent on the purpose of the cookie and the legal requirements for data retention as mandated by the governing regulations.
